In re H.G.
Citations
- 2023 Ohio 4082
Syllabus
The juvenile court did not err in granting permanent custody of the children to the children services agency where the children had been in the temporary custody of the agency for more than 12 months of a consecutive 22-month period and the award of permanent custody to the agency was in the children's best interest.
